* The discharge check signal indicates that discharge current is flowing normally. The setpoint
of this instrument is not actuated unless this signal is input.

10.6.
Signals
10.6.1.
Output voltage
Output voltage is outputted with the I/O con[8pin]
→
GND [15 pin].
P = 10
×
(V-E)
×
10 ^ ( E – 8 + C )
P : Pressure value (Pressure)
V : Measurement value output voltage (V)
E : Measurement value output voltage V from which fractions are rounded off
C : Exponent value of Calculation value
(The value of C in A.B
×
10
C
, refer to section18)
The (V-E) calculated value may become 0.1 or lower due to errors in the sensor's output voltage
and errors with the measuring instrument. If it falls below 0.1 in this manner, we recommend
rounding up to 0.1 and calculating.
